In
terms of the business benefits associated
with soy, just ask John Hardy of Prince
Edward Island.
The
family company, Maritime Soy Craft grows
soy, processes it into tofu and distributes
the products to several food store chains
across the Atlantic Provinces.
Between
1997-2000 the sales of soy and rice beverages
grew 403%.
|
John
purchased the turnkey soy manufacturing
business to provide additional income for
the family farm.
It's
also provided added responsibilities and
a new business direction.
The
organic foods market represents 1% of total
retail sales in Canada and is growing at
an average annual rate of over 15%.
Just
prior to the business purchase, the previous
owner made an additional two to three weeks
worth of extra orders to cover any shortages
from potential downtime and keep customers
happy.

To
expand their customer base and further diversify
their product line, John is looking at going
into markets outside the Atlantic Provinces.
